How to fill out capstone project proposal

01
Step 1: Start by understanding the requirements of the capstone project proposal. Read the guidelines and instructions provided by your institution or supervisor.
02
Step 2: Choose a topic for your capstone project that aligns with your field of study and interests. Make sure it is feasible and can be completed within the given time frame.
03
Step 3: Conduct thorough research on your chosen topic. Gather relevant information, data, and resources to support your proposal.
04
Step 4: Outline your proposal in a clear and structured manner. Include sections such as introduction, objectives, methodology, expected outcomes, timeline, and budget.
05
Step 5: Write a compelling introduction that explains the significance of your project and highlights its relevance to the field.
06
Step 6: Clearly state the objectives of your capstone project and explain how you plan to achieve them.
07
Step 7: Describe the methodology you will use to conduct your research or complete your project. Justify why this approach is appropriate and feasible.
08
Step 8: Outline the expected outcomes and impact of your project. Discuss how it can contribute to the existing knowledge or solve a real-world problem.
09
Step 9: Create a realistic timeline that outlines the different stages or milestones of your project. This will help you stay organized and ensure timely completion.
10
Step 10: Provide a budget estimate for your capstone project. Include any anticipated expenses such as equipment, materials, or travel.
11
Step 11: Revise and proofread your proposal before final submission. Make sure it is well-written, coherent, and free from errors.
12
Step 12: Submit your capstone project proposal within the specified deadline and follow any additional instructions or requirements provided by your institution or supervisor.

Who needs capstone project proposal?

01
Capstone project proposals are typically required by students who are pursuing undergraduate or graduate degrees in various fields.
02
Students who are part of capstone or senior project courses, research programs, or thesis tracks usually need to submit a project proposal.
03
In addition to students, professionals or researchers who are applying for grants, funding, or research opportunities may also need to prepare a capstone project proposal.
04
Educational institutions, research organizations, and funding agencies often require project proposals to assess the feasibility, significance, and potential impact of a proposed project.

A capstone project proposal is a formal document that outlines the planned research or project to be undertaken as part of an academic program, typically in the final phases of a degree. It includes objectives, methodology, and expected outcomes.
Students enrolled in a capstone course or program as part of their academic curriculum, typically in undergraduate or graduate studies, are required to file a capstone project proposal.
To fill out a capstone project proposal, students should first review their program guidelines, outline their project objectives, methodology, and timeline, and ensure they include any necessary sections such as an abstract, literature review, and bibliography before submitting it for approval.
The purpose of a capstone project proposal is to ensure that students have a clear and structured plan for their research or project, allowing faculty to provide guidance and assess the feasibility and relevance of the proposed work.
A capstone project proposal should typically include the project title, objectives, background information, project methodology, a timeline, and any resources or support needed to complete the project.
